Output 50883ed756a40ccd7135b323ea881e19dde77d70ca8e69befdec1f7bc30d37d9:12

value
52565
script pubkey
OP_0 OP_PUSHBYTES_20 966b49988abba7fc8500859c6881f32247e801e2
address
bc1qje45nxy2hwnlepgqskwx3q0nyfr7sq0z7dxhts
transaction
50883ed756a40ccd7135b323ea881e19dde77d70ca8e69befdec1f7bc30d37d9
confirmations
342
spent
true